Cold Asparagus with Prosciutto and Lemon

This cold asparagus appetizer or side dish features small bundles of blanched stalks wrapped in prosciutto and garnished with lemon zest and juice.

Preparation Time
15 mins
Cooking Time
10 mins
Total Time
25 mins
Calories
83 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a rolling boil. Cook asparagus in boiling water until tender but still crisp, about 4 minutes. Quickly drain asparagus and plunge into a bowl of ice water to stop cooking and maintain the bright green color. Drain again and pat dry with paper towels.
Step 2
Separate asparagus into 5 small bundles and wrap each one with a prosciutto slice. Sprinkle each bundle with lemon juice and zest.

Ingredients

  • 1 teaspoon lemon zest
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 pound fresh asparagus, trimmed
  • 1 (3 ounce) package prosciutto
